Hot Cocoa Brownies - cooking recipe
Ingredients
-
2 cups hot cocoa mix
3/4 cup butter
2 cups white sugar
3 eggs
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1/4 cup milk
1 cup all-purpose white flour
Preparation
-
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 9x11-inch baking pan.
Place hot cocoa mix and butter in a large microwave-safe bowl; microwave until butter is mostly melted, about 3 minutes. Stir well. Add sugar, eggs, and vanilla extract and mix thoroughly. Add milk; mix until batter is thick and creamy. Mix in flour.
Bake in the preheated oven in 5 to 10 minute increments until set and sticky in texture, 25 to 65 minutes. Let cool for 10 minutes before cutting into bars.
